The Role of Text-to-Speech in a Predictive Dialer

By Mae Kowalke, TMCnet Contributor


When we think of dialers, we think of a little beep in our headset and a voice on the other end. We think of predictive dialers as saving us the time and hassle of having to dial a bunch of numbers until we reach a live person.

Indeed, this is one of the most common uses for dialing software. But it is not the only use.

Dialers can also be used to serve up reminders to customers and clients when paired with our customer relations management system and text-to-speech functionality.

The Spitfire predictive dialer, for instance, has a text-to-speech add-on that allows the dialer to serve as an automated message service.

By combining text-to-speech with a CRM system, the dialer can serve up appointment reminders, merchandise pickup notices, delivery notices, payment reminders, collection notices, emergency alerts, and probably some that nobody has thought of yet.


These messages can get pretty personal, too, thanks to the power of text-to-speech crossed with database information from the CRM. A call could go out to Dan Johnson that uses his name in the call, for instance, tells him that he still owes $200 on his bill dated four months ago, and even lets him know what payment options are available to him based on his particular outstanding balance.

Of course, there are many, many possibilities for a dialer that can interface with your CRM system and a database, and that can leave a message with customers.

This functionality can work both with live calls or when a voicemail is reached.

Some of the other uses for text-to-speech in a dialer include offering a pre-recorded message in several different languages so the person being called will be able to both hear and understand the message, and allowing customers to schedule and confirm appointments through the system.

Dialers can significantly cut down on appointment no-shows, and can play an important role in getting out information to a large list of contacts.

Obviously, there’s more to dialers than just assisting with the dialing process.
